Output 21bf0680c6633614d117d027692f64d3e7d652bd7c9b5d5b26aac416ec50fa14:0

value
1607745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fe586fe89c2b5d8099cd62278cae42939640140 OP_EQUAL
address
3AS55c5EFsKgWp9HYzpjZQrKa3b7jZVkvW
transaction
21bf0680c6633614d117d027692f64d3e7d652bd7c9b5d5b26aac416ec50fa14
spent
true